Profile
Through this Master’s Degree Programme in Biosciences: Evolutionary Biology students will acquire an explicit evolutionary biological perspective in the study of nature, thereby increasing capacity for understanding patterns and processes, on scales varying from the cellular to the ecosystem level.In Evolutionary Biology track the focus is on deepening knowledge of evolutionary biology, ecology, genetics, and physiology, with a special focus on bioinformatic and computational methods for analyzing and interpreting evolutionary and NGS data, both modern and ancient DNA.You will get strong background for working with phenotypic and genetic variation, both theory and practice. The practice focuses on bioinformatics and statistical analyses using various platforms, where a number of courses include hands-on computer practicals, to provide the student with concrete data analysis skills much sought after in both research and industry.
